As a Full-Stack Developer within the Customer Success Innovation Development Team at IES Services & Engagement Solutions Engineering, your role encompasses a dynamic range of responsibilities:
• Communication and Collaboration: Actively participate in daily Scrum Meetings to stay aligned with project goals and progress. Collaborate closely with the development team to comprehend tool requirements, provide valuable input, and ensure clear communication within the international team.
• Tool Development and Enhancement: Familiarize yourself with the development processes of prototypes and tools for services related to SAP's cloud solutions. Engage in software design, development, and implementation within a cloud environment.


What you bring

• Student (f/m/d) at a university or a university of applied science

• Preferred Fields of Study: A background in Computer Science or Business Information is preferred, providing a strong foundation for the technical and business aspects of the role.
• Computer Skills: Showcase your proficiency in a range of technologies, including but not limited to Node.js, React.js, SAP UI5, SAP CAP, and JavaScript. Your ability to adapt to new technologies and coding languages will be a valuable asset.
• Language Skills: Demonstrate excellent verbal and written English language skills, as effective communication is key within our international team.
• Soft Skills: Highlight your soft skills that contribute to a collaborative and innovative work environment. Whether you are a team player, an expert in organizing tasks, a creative thinker, or have a geeky passion for specific technologies, these attributes will enrich our team dynamics.
• Others: Share any relevant work experience or projects that showcase your practical application of development skills. While prior work experience is beneficial, a strong enthusiasm for learning and a proactive attitude are equally important.



Your set of application documents should contain a cover letter, a resume in table form, school leaving certificates, certificate of enrollment, current university transcript of records, copies of any academic degrees already earned, and if available, references from former employers (including internships). Please also describe your experience and skills in foreign languages and computer programs / programming languages.
